Course Content

• Understanding Child Development in STEM Fields
• STEM Toys and Activities: Selection and Implementation
• Fostering STEM Curiosity and Exploration in Children
• Supporting STEM Learning through Play-Based Activities
• Addressing Gender and Cultural Biases in STEM Education
• Encouraging Problem-Solving and Critical Thinking Skills in STEM
• The Role of Parents in STEM Education: Advocacy and Support
• Identifying and Addressing Learning Challenges in STEM
• STEM Career Exploration and Guidance for Young Learners
